Uyo Court remands pastor for defiling minor

An Uyo High Court has ordered the remanding of a 32-year-old prophet, Godson Thompson for allegedly raping a 13-year old minor.

Justice Bassey Nkanang insisted that the accused, a native of Ikot Offiong Nsit in the Nsit Ibom Local Government Area, be kept in the Uyo Custodial Centre.

The victim while narrating her ordeal to the Uyo Court said she was living with her elder sister in Uyo when her in-law took her to a church located at Information Drive, Uyo.

According to her, the pastor conveyed her to his house when the in law left around 6pm and raped her.

The minor continued that the prophet prevented her from going out and even gave her a bucket to urinate inside the house to achieve his aim.

The SS1 student said she escaped when the accused person forgot to lock the door of the house, adding that she ran to a church where she was rescued.

Justice Nkanang adjourned the matter till August 1, 2022, for continuation of trial.
